Hello everyone,

I built a Silismile and socketed the transistors. I tried multiple combinations of 2n5088s, 2n3904s, 2n2222, and others with a max hfe on Q2 of about 350. Nothing seems to bring the gain up to what sounds right to me. It's not bad but a little underwhelming.

My question: is there any big difference in this circuit that R3 and R5 would limit the gain compared to a fuzzface, or am I just needing to order some BC108s or BC108Cs and that might open it up?

Thanks for any help!

Sean

Edit: I forgot to add that I play through a Plexi clone with some breakup, and then a clean Princeton to compare.

I knew if I asked you guys you would get me in the right direction. Problem solved and now it sounds like it should! Now
I can experiment with transistors properly.
I reflowed all of the joints and at least one looked suspect (C2 negative), then cleaned the board with alcohol. Also on the off board wiring there was one tiny strand of stray wire that might have been causing issues. Maybe the ground wasn't good. I thought it was working since nothing was cutting out just a bit weak in the fuzz department and volume. If someone likes a tame fuzz it was even useable through the Marshall.
